background image

 

 

1               

 

 

 

 

 

 

 

Marvelmind Indoor Navigation System

 

Operating instructions for beacon

 

V2017_05_02

 

 

 

www.marvelmind.com

 

 

 

 

 

 

 

 

 

User Manual

Beacon HW v4.9   

915MHz

Summary of Contents for Beacon HW v4.9

Page 1: ...1 Marvelmind Indoor Navigation System Operating instructions for beacon V2017_05_02 www marvelmind com User Manual Beacon HW v4 9 915MHz ...

Page 2: ...e Dashboard 12 4 3 Using the system after the very first setup 16 5 Interfaces 17 5 1 Beacon HW v4 9 external interface 4x4 pinout 18 6 Advanced system settings and optimization 19 6 1 Using oscilloscopes 19 6 1 1 Monitor ultrasonic signal from one beacon to another 19 6 1 2 Proper ultrasonic signal detection 20 6 2 Using hedgehog log file 21 6 3 Important aspects and hints 22 6 4 Deep hints 23 6 ...

Page 3: ...rasonic beacons united by radio interface in license free band Location of a mobile beacon installed on a robot vehicle copter human VR is calculated based on the propagation delay of ultrasonic signal Time Of Flight or TOF to a set of stationary ultrasonic beacons using trilateration Key requirement for the system to function properly is An unobstructed sight by a mobile beacon of three or more s...

Page 4: ...ons Beacons form the navigation system automatically no manual coordinates measurements or entering required except of height Sensor 4 to sensor 4 direct line all other sensors are disabled Parameter Technical Specifications Distance between beacons Up to 50 meters Recommended 30 meters Transducer4 to Transducer4 looking straight to each other and other transducers are off Coverage area Up to 1000...

Page 5: ...m 3 1 What s in the box Starter Set 4xStationary beacons 1xMobile beacon aka hedgehog Deleted part Exact appearance may wary depending on the Hardware version Characteristics are kept the same or better unless specially noted ...

Page 6: ...architecture Marvelmind Indoor Navigation System provides high precision 2 cm indoor coordinates for autonomous robots and systems indoor GPS Brief description of the key elements of the system is given on scheme below ...

Page 7: ...7 3 3 Indoor GPS beacon s inside view ...

Page 8: ...at maximum coverage in ultrasonic is provided for the maximum territory Proper ultrasonic coverage is the utmost important element for the system to function effectively Stationary beacons emit and receive ultrasound when the map is being formed And they only receive the ultrasound when the map is formed and frozen Stationary beacons have no exterior difference with mobile beacons Inertial measure...

Page 9: ...in one or more mobile beacons Current implementation relies on time division multiple access approach Thus if two mobile beacons are activated they share the time It means that if 16 Hz update rate is selected and there are 2 mobile beacons in the system each beacon s location will be updated with the rate of 16Hz 2 8Hz If there are 3 mobile beacons 16Hz 3 5Hz etc Future SW implementation will con...

Page 10: ... beacon in this mode and to not touch the DIP switch at all unless you want to store the beacon on the shelf Then the mode 1 is better and recommended 3 Power ON DFU ON DFU programming mode It is used for the very initial SW uploading or when the HEX SW cannot be uploaded from the Dashboard for some reasons Charge your board from USB Charging is done automatically every time when the USB charger i...

Page 11: ...1 1 Unpack the system Watch the help video https youtu be IyXB3UXHdeQ Note that the video is shot for the previous HW version 4 5 4 1 2 Check that your board is charged see that all switches on beacons are in the correct position See paragraph detailed description and charging 4 1 3 If LED is not blinking it means your board is turned off please check the position of DIP switch again if everything...

Page 12: ...ases 4 2 5 While beacon is connected to the Dashboard press Default button to upload the default settings 4 2 6 Write down and use later the beacon s address or change the address to your convenience as shown here 4 2 7 Press RESET button on your beacons after programming 4 2 8 After programming devices with the latest software beacons are ready for use Place stationary beacons on the walls vertic...

Page 13: ... beacons on the map scroll it so you will be able to find their addresses 4 2 10 Also double click on the device to go into sleeping mode and double clicking to wake up 4 2 11 The map will form automatically and zoom in automatically 4 2 12 If the map does not form well Check the Table of distances in the left corner of the Dashboard Cells must be colored in white it means the distances between st...

Page 14: ...he problems with those beacons are Try to re position them because usually there is an obstruction of some sort in the between the beacons Reset them Use View Table of distances to monitor the measured distances between beacons 4 2 13 Freeze the map by clicking the button Stationary beacons will stop measuring relative distances and will be ready to measure distance from the mobile beacon s ...

Page 15: ... off or some ultrasonic or radio settings are different You can change the settings for sensors manually by clicking on the panel in the right corner of the dashboard and make grey cells green to turn on sensor But for starting it is very much recommended to use default settings on all beacons 4 2 16 After you froze the map of stationary beacons wake up the mobile beacon After it wakes up it will ...

Page 16: ...16 4 3 Using the system after the very first setup 4 3 1 To be described in another manual ...

Page 17: ...t copter VR There are two different ways to get mobile beacons location data from the system From mobile beacons o Each mobile beacon knows its own position and doesn t know position of other mobile beacons List of supported interfaces is shown below More on the interfaces can be found on the link http marvelmind com Interfaces ...

Page 18: ...18 5 1 Beacon HW v4 9 external interface 4x4 pinout ...

Page 19: ...Dashboard View Oscilloscope to monitor ultrasonic signal from one beacon to another It is a very powerful tool because it gives also information on the background noise level of the signal echo With this tool it is easy to set up the proper ultrasonic threshold in the Dashboard Use this tool to set up the proper ultrasonic threshold in the Dashboard Echo External noise looks similarly Thus choose ...

Page 20: ...ntify the beacons that are affected Usually they are those that the closest to the source of noise 2 manually reduce the gain of the affected stationary beacons so that the signal from the mobile beacon has 1000 1800 amplitude That would give the best signal to noise ratio Don t make the gain too high The noise will be amplified but the desired signal will be saturated and signal to noise ratio wi...

Page 21: ...21 6 2 Using hedgehog log file System automatically records all measured positions in hedgehog log file that is stored in the same folder as the Dashboard exe file ...

Page 22: ...they cover 360 degrees horizontally and upper hemisphere Lower hemisphere is highly attenuated so don t expect ultrasonic coverage in that area It is advised to place the mobile beacon as high as possible on the robot if stationary beacons are above the mobile beacon to minimize shadows from other objects people etc Example of proper positioning of the mobile beacon https youtu be PFgNPkLGCDk the ...

Page 23: ...to a long horizontal metal tube may result in the following Sound emitted from the beacon propagates directly to the metal tube Propagation loses inside metal are much smaller than in the air Moreover the tube may act as a low loss waveguide If the tube is solid enough and long enough there may be a weird effect when the receiving beacon receives the signal sooner than expected i e sooner than the...

Page 24: ... gives 2y shelf time with a regular 1000mAh battery Beacon can be woken up from deep sleep only by pressing HW reset button In regular sleeping mode the beacons wake up automatically every 2 seconds That brings some additional consumption but still leaves several months in sleep mode Active mode work time directly depends on the location update rate For example With the standard 1000mAh battery an...

Page 25: ...25 6 6 Different colors in the Dashboard menu To be added in the next Manual release 6 7 Ultrasonic coverage To be added in the next Manual release 6 8 Submaps To be added in the next Manual release ...

Page 26: ...tions may cause harmful interference to radio communications However there is no guarantee that interference will not occur in a particular installation If this equipment does cause harmful interference to radio or television reception which can be determined by turning the equipment off and on the user is encouraged to try to correct the interference by one or more of the following measures Reori...

Reviews: